Etymology 3

edit

Kanji in this term
Grade: 2 Jinmeiyō
irregular
Alternative spelling
東莱

Unknown; probably not directly from Korean 동래(東萊) (dongnae), as the phonetics are problematic.

Perhaps from Early Modern Korean *동령(東令) (*twonglyeng), a shortening of 동ᄅᆡ 령감(東萊令監) (twongloy lyengkam), referring to government officials from Dongnae.
